Dairne and Graham have both been sailing since the 1950s, when they sailed in Southampton Water.

We kept our wodden sloop Fay-A till 1995, then purchased Ariadne, a new Rustler 36. Since then we have mainly done short handed (2 person) Channel cruising till 2001, when retirement allowed more ambitious cruising – usually 3+ months each summer. Destinations have included Hebrides, Orkney, Round Ireland (the Log won the RYA Cruising Log competition), S Brittany, La Rochelle and Gironde. Logged distance in Ariadne has exceeded 36,000 nautical miles.

 

Later we assisted our eldest son, resident in Auckland, to purchase a 42ft cutter “True” in New Zealand. We have both cruised from Auckland to Bay of Islands and Great Barrier Island, with Iain, and on our own.

 

In early 2012 Dairne suffered a serious stroke. We carried on sailing for a while, but the angle of heel especially when beating spoilt the enjoyment for her. So at the end of 2015, we bought Teal, a Hardy 36 Commodore motor boat, thoroughly described elsewhere n this website. Ariadne was put on the market an sold at the end of 2015, but we will still follow her adventures in the Golden Globe Race
